买球的正规网站 0916-87540054

硬见小百科:单片机中断系统

作者:买球的正规网站 时间:2022-04-01 01:34
本文摘要:单片机设计中断系统的概念什么叫中断,大家从一个日常生活的方法引入。你已经家里一天到晚,突然电话声敲了,你拿出书籍,去接听电话,和来电話的人闲聊,随后拿出电話,回来以后看着你的书。 生活就是这样中的“中断”的状况,便是长期的工作中全过程被外界的恶性事件慢下来了。仔细科学研究一下日常生活的中断,针对大家通过自学单片机设计的中断也很有好处。第一、哪些可经引发中断。

买球的正规网站

单片机设计中断系统的概念什么叫中断,大家从一个日常生活的方法引入。你已经家里一天到晚,突然电话声敲了,你拿出书籍,去接听电话,和来电話的人闲聊,随后拿出电話,回来以后看着你的书。

生活就是这样中的“中断”的状况,便是长期的工作中全过程被外界的恶性事件慢下来了。仔细科学研究一下日常生活的中断,针对大家通过自学单片机设计的中断也很有好处。第一、哪些可经引发中断。

日常生活许多 恶性事件能引发中断:有些人按了电子门铃了,电话声敲了,你的闹铃闹得敲了,你火烤的水进了…这些诸如此类的恶性事件,大家把能引发中断的称之为中断源。单片机设计中也有一些能引发中断的恶性事件,8031中一共有五个:2个外部中断,2个记数/计时器中断,一个串行接口中断。第二、中断的嵌入与优先处置。

构想一下,大家已经一天到晚,电话声敲了,另外又有些人按了电子门铃,你该再作保证那般呢?假如你更是在等一个很最重要的电話,你一般会去理睬电子门铃的,而相反,你已经等一个最重要的顾客,则有可能便会去理睬电話了。要不是这二者(即均值电話,也不是等上门服务),你很有可能会按你常常的习惯性去处置。

总而言之这儿不会有一个优先的难题,单片机设计中也是这般,也是有优先的难题。优先的难题某种意义再次出现在2个中断另外造成的状况,也再次出现在一个中断已造成,又有一个中断造成的状况,例如你因此以接听电话,有些人按电子门铃的状况,或你因此以大门口和人闲聊,又有电话通了状况。

考虑一下大家不容易该怎么办吧。第三、中断的呼吁全过程。当有恶性事件造成,转到中断以前大家必不可少再作忘记如今一天到晚的第几页了,或拿一个便签放进当页的方向,随后去处置不一样的事儿(由于处置完后,大家也要回来以后一天到晚):电话声响大家以前敲电話的地区去,电子门铃响我们要到门那里去,也讲到是不一样的中断,我们要在不一样的地址处置,而这一地址常常還是同样的。

买球的正规网站

电子计算机中也是应用的这类方法,五个中断源,每一个中断造成后都到一个同样的地区去找处置这一中断的程序流程,自然在去以前最先要存留下边将继续执行的命令的详细地址,便于处置完后中断后回到本来的地区以后向下程序执行。具体地说,中断呼吁能分为下列好多个流程:1、维护保养中断点,即存留下一将要继续执行的命令的详细地址,便是把这个详细地址送至局部变量。

买球的正规网站

2、寻找中断通道,依据五个不一样的中断源所造成的中断,查看五个不一样的通道详细地址。之上工作中是由电子计算机全自动顺利完成的,与程序编写者涉及。在这里五个通道详细地址处储放在有中断程序处理(它是程序流程编写时放进那里的,要是没有把中断程序流程放进那里,就拢了,中断程序流程就没法被继续执行到)。

3、继续执行中断程序处理。4、中断返回:继续执行完后中断命令后,就从中断处返回到源程序,继续执行。MCS-51单片机中断系统软件的构造五个中断源的标记、名字及造成的标准以下。INT0:外部中断0,由P3.2端口号线引入,低电频或下跳沿引发。

INT1:外部中断1,由P3.3端口号线引入,低电频或下跳沿引发。T0:计时器/电子计数器0中断,由T0计满回零引发。T1:计时器/电子计数器l中断,由T1计满回零引发。

TI/RI:串行通信I/O中断,串行通信端口号顺利完成一帧标识符发送至/对接后引发。全部中断系统软件的构造框架图闻下图下图。


本文关键词:硬见,买球的正规网站,小百科,单片机,中断,系统,单片机,设计

本文来源:买球的正规网站-www.moomd.com